Monster Hunter Portable 2nd G is still considered one of the hottest games out in Japan right now. It's no small wonder that Capcom is still churning out downloadable quests to keep the game fresh and players wanting more out of this action-packed title.

The latest event quest for the game puts both veteran and novice monster hunters up against the fearsome Tigarex beast in the old desert. In addition, Capcom will be giving players a chance to feel like a real hunter with several new Monster Hunter goods that were featured during the recent Monster Hunter Festa '08 event.
